diff options
Diffstat (limited to 'Master')
-rw-r--r-- | Master/texmf-dist/doc/platex/base/LICENSE | 6 | ||||
-rw-r--r-- | Master/texmf-dist/doc/platex/base/README.md | 2 | ||||
-rw-r--r-- | Master/texmf-dist/doc/platex/base/exppl2e.pdf | bin | 165049 -> 165049 bytes | |||
-rw-r--r-- | Master/texmf-dist/doc/platex/base/platexrelease.pdf | bin | 121442 -> 121553 bytes | |||
-rw-r--r-- | Master/texmf-dist/doc/platex/base/pldoc.pdf | bin | 798011 -> 798709 bytes | |||
-rw-r--r-- | Master/texmf-dist/source/platex/base/platexrelease.dtx | 2 | ||||
-rw-r--r-- | Master/texmf-dist/source/platex/base/plcore.dtx | 8 | ||||
-rw-r--r-- | Master/texmf-dist/source/platex/base/plnewsc09.tex | 81 | ||||
-rw-r--r-- | Master/texmf-dist/source/platex/base/plvers.dtx | 2 | ||||
-rw-r--r-- | Master/texmf-dist/tex/platex/base/exppl2e.sty | 9 | ||||
-rw-r--r-- | Master/texmf-dist/tex/platex/base/platexrelease.sty | 6 | ||||
-rw-r--r-- | Master/texmf-dist/tex/platex/base/plcore.ltx | 6 |
12 files changed, 105 insertions, 17 deletions
diff --git a/Master/texmf-dist/doc/platex/base/LICENSE b/Master/texmf-dist/doc/platex/base/LICENSE index c052ebeb9c0..dc26b0028a8 100644 --- a/Master/texmf-dist/doc/platex/base/LICENSE +++ b/Master/texmf-dist/doc/platex/base/LICENSE @@ -12,9 +12,9 @@ modification, are permitted provided that the following conditions are met: this list of conditions and the following disclaimer in the documentation and/or other materials provided with the distribution. -* Neither the name of platex nor the names of its - contributors may be used to endorse or promote products derived from - this software without specific prior written permission. +* Neither the name of the copyright holder nor the names of its contributors + may be used to endorse or promote products derived from this software + without specific prior written permission. TH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E diff --git a/Master/texmf-dist/doc/platex/base/README.md b/Master/texmf-dist/doc/platex/base/README.md index 49daab3fb2b..4b93f85235c 100644 --- a/Master/texmf-dist/doc/platex/base/README.md +++ b/Master/texmf-dist/doc/platex/base/README.md @@ -61,6 +61,6 @@ the 3-clause BSD license (see [LICENSE](./LICENSE)). ## Release Date -2018-03-09 +2018-03-16 Japanese TeX Development Community diff --git a/Master/texmf-dist/doc/platex/base/exppl2e.pdf b/Master/texmf-dist/doc/platex/base/exppl2e.pdf Binary files differindex afc156db405..6edfb0d3f7f 100644 --- a/Master/texmf-dist/doc/platex/base/exppl2e.pdf +++ b/Master/texmf-dist/doc/platex/base/exppl2e.pdf diff --git a/Master/texmf-dist/doc/platex/base/platexrelease.pdf b/Master/texmf-dist/doc/platex/base/platexrelease.pdf Binary files differindex 7e331901248..9351a4007f8 100644 --- a/Master/texmf-dist/doc/platex/base/platexrelease.pdf +++ b/Master/texmf-dist/doc/platex/base/platexrelease.pdf diff --git a/Master/texmf-dist/doc/platex/base/pldoc.pdf b/Master/texmf-dist/doc/platex/base/pldoc.pdf Binary files differindex 6d7eda7ff80..6964de7ce4b 100644 --- a/Master/texmf-dist/doc/platex/base/pldoc.pdf +++ b/Master/texmf-dist/doc/platex/base/pldoc.pdf diff --git a/Master/texmf-dist/source/platex/base/platexrelease.dtx b/Master/texmf-dist/source/platex/base/platexrelease.dtx index ebfd5305369..3ed5b4dc385 100644 --- a/Master/texmf-dist/source/platex/base/platexrelease.dtx +++ b/Master/texmf-dist/source/platex/base/platexrelease.dtx @@ -313,6 +313,8 @@ of this package available from CTAN} some critical bugs. We advise you to\MessageBreak select another format date} \plIncludeInRelease{2017/10/28}{\PackageWarning}{pLaTeX Info}% + % * <2018/03/09>+1 + % * <2018/03/09> % * <2017/10/28>+4 \plEndIncludeInRelease \plIncludeInRelease{2017/07/29}{\PackageWarning}{pLaTeX Info}% diff --git a/Master/texmf-dist/source/platex/base/plcore.dtx b/Master/texmf-dist/source/platex/base/plcore.dtx index f15de60e8e7..dd8137673d7 100644 --- a/Master/texmf-dist/source/platex/base/plcore.dtx +++ b/Master/texmf-dist/source/platex/base/plcore.dtx @@ -85,13 +85,14 @@ % \changes{v1.2x}{2018/03/01}{\cs{removejfmglue}$B$,$"$l$PMxMQ$9$k$h$&$K$7$?(B} % \changes{v1.2x}{2018/03/01}{$B%;%k:G=i$N(B\cs{par}$B$G6u9T$,F~$i$J$$$h$&$K$7$?(B} % \changes{v1.2x}{2018/03/01}{\cs{everypar}$B$K(B\cs{inhibitglue}$B$r;E9~$`%^%/%mDI2C(B} +% \changes{v1.2y}{2018/03/12}{\cs{inhibitglue}$B$r(B\cs{everypar}$B$NKvHx$K0\F0(B} % \fi % % \iffalse %<*driver> \NeedsTeXFormat{pLaTeX2e} % \fi -\ProvidesFile{plcore.dtx}[2018/03/01 v1.2x pLaTeX core file] +\ProvidesFile{plcore.dtx}[2018/03/12 v1.2y pLaTeX core file] % \iffalse \documentclass{jltxdoc} \GetFileInfo{plcore.dtx} @@ -1857,15 +1858,16 @@ % $B?eJ?%b!<%I$G$"$l$P$=$N$^$^(B|\inhibitglue|$B$rH/9T$7!"$=$l0J30$G$"$l$P(B % |\everypar|$BFb$K(B|\inhibitglue|$B$r;E9~$_$^$9!#(B % \changes{v1.2x}{2018/03/01}{\cs{everypar}$B$K(B\cs{inhibitglue}$B$r;E9~$`%^%/%mDI2C(B} +% \changes{v1.2y}{2018/03/12}{\cs{inhibitglue}$B$r(B\cs{everypar}$B$NKvHx$K0\F0(B} % \begin{macrocode} %<platexrelease>\plIncludeInRelease{2018/03/09}{\pltx@next@inhibitglue} %<platexrelease> {Add \pltx@next@inhibitglue}% %<*plcore|platexrelease> \protected\def\pltx@next@inhibitglue{% \ifhmode\inhibitglue\else - \edef\@tempa{\everypar{\inhibitglue + \edef\@tempa{\everypar{% \everypar{\unexpanded\expandafter{\the\everypar}}% - \unexpanded\expandafter{\the\everypar}}}% + \unexpanded\expandafter{\the\everypar}\inhibitglue}}% \@tempa\fi} %</plcore|platexrelease> %<platexrelease>\plEndIncludeInRelease diff --git a/Master/texmf-dist/source/platex/base/plnewsc09.tex b/Master/texmf-dist/source/platex/base/plnewsc09.tex new file mode 100644 index 00000000000..3944f5ec7e6 --- /dev/null +++ b/Master/texmf-dist/source/platex/base/plnewsc09.tex @@ -0,0 +1,81 @@ +%% <2018/03/09> +\documentclass{plnews} + +\publicationyear{2018}% $BH/9TG/(B +\publicationmonth{03}% $BH/9T7n(B +\publicationissue{c9}% $BHV9f(B +\author{$BF|K\8l(B\TeX{}$B3+H/%3%_%e%K%F%#!J(B\texttt{https://texjp.org/}$B!K(B} + +\def\cs#1{\texttt{\char92 #1}} +\def\pTeX{p\kern-.15em\TeX} +\def\eTeX{$\varepsilon$-\TeX} +\def\epTeX{$\varepsilon$-\pTeX} +\def\pLaTeX{p\kern-.05em\LaTeX} +\def\pLaTeXe{p\kern-.05em\LaTeXe} + +\begin{document} + +\maketitle + +$B$3$NJ8=q$O%3%_%e%K%F%#HG(B\pLaTeXe\ \texttt{<2018/03/09>}$B$K$D$$$F!"(B +\pLaTeXe\ \texttt{<2017/10/28>}$B$+$i$N99?72U=j$r$^$H$a$?$b$N$G$9!#(B + + +\section{tabular$B4D6-$N2~NI(B} +\pLaTeXe\ \texttt{<2017/07/29>}$B$GF3F~$7$?(B|tabular|$B4D6-$N=$@5J}?K$r(B +$BE>49$7!"$h$j(B\LaTeXe{}$B$H$N8_49@-$r9b$a$^$7$?!#6qBNE*$K$O(B +\begin{verbatim} + \begin{tabular}{p{5cm}} + A\\ + \relax\par + A + \end{tabular} +\end{verbatim} +$B$N$h$&$J%=!<%9$GM>J,$J6u9T$,F~$i$J$$$h$&$K$7$^$7$?!#(B +$B$3$l$r<B8=$9$k$?$a$K8e=R$9$k(B|\removejfmglue|$BL?Na$r;HMQ$7$F$$$^$9!#(B + + +\section{\cs{removejfmglue}$BL?Na$NDI2C(B} +\<$B!V:G8e$N%N!<%I$,(BJFM $B%0%k!<$G$"$C$?>l9g$K$=$l$r:o=|$9$k!W$H$$$&5!G=$r(B +$B;}$D(B|\removejfmglue|$BL?Na$rDI2C$7$^$7$?!#$?$@$7!"$3$l$O(B\epTeX\ 180226$B0J9_$K(B +$B<BAu$5$l$?(B|\lastnodesubtype|$B$H$$$&%W%j%_%F%#%V$,MxMQ2DG=$J>l9g$N$_;H$($^$9!#(B + + +\section{$BOBJ8%9%1!<%kCM$N?75,Ls(B} +$BF|K\8lMQ%/%i%9%U%!%$%k$N?7$?$J6&DL5,Ls$H$7$F!"?7$?$K(B +$B!V%/%i%9%U%!%$%k$,0U?^$9$kOBJ8%9%1!<%kCM(B +$B!J(B$1\,\mathrm{zw} \div \textmc{$BMW5a%5%$%:(B}$$B!K!W(B +$B$r?tCM%^%/%m(B|\Cjascale|$B$GDj5A$9$k$3$H$K$7$^$7$?!#:#8e$O(B +\begin{itemize} +\item $BF|K\8l%/%i%9%U%!%$%k$N:n@.<T$O!"(B + $B86B'$H$7$F(B|\Cjascale|$B$rOBJ8%9%1!<%kCM$K@_Dj$9$k!#(B +\item $BF|K\8l%U%)%s%H$rJQ99$9$k%Q%C%1!<%8$J$I$N:n<T$O!"(B + $B86B'$H$7$F%/%i%9%U%!%$%k$,Dj$a$k(B|\Cjascale|$B$r;2>H$9$k!#(B +\end{itemize} +$B$H$$$&1?MQ$r?d>)$7$^$9!#(B + + +\section{\pLaTeX{}$B$H(Bu\pLaTeX{}$B$N6&DL2=(B} +2016$BG/0J9_!"(B\pLaTeX{}$B$H(Bu\pLaTeX{}$B$r$H$b$KF|K\8l(B\TeX{}$B3+H/%3%_%e%K%F%#$,(B +$B4IM}$9$k$h$&$K$J$C$?$3$H$+$i!"(B\TeX\ Live 2018$B0J9_$G$O(B\pLaTeX{}$B$H(B +u\pLaTeX{}$B$N%U%)!<%^%C%H:n@.;~$K;H$o$l$k(B|.ltx|$B%U%!%$%k72$r(B +$BBgI}$K6&DL2=$7$^$7$?!#$3$l$K$h$j!"=>Mh$O(Bu\pLaTeX{}$B$r(B\pLaTeX{}$B$HFHN)$K(B +$B%$%s%9%H!<%k$9$k$3$H$,$G$-$^$7$?$,!":#8e$O(Bu\pLaTeX{}$B$,(B\pLaTeX{}$B$K(B +$B0MB8$9$k$3$H$K$J$j$^$9!#(B + + +\section{$B3+H/HG$N%F%9%H$N$*4j$$(B} +$B:#8e(B\pLaTeX{}$B$KF3F~$9$k$+$b$7$l$J$$=$@5%Q%C%A$d;EMMJQ99$N%F%9%H$K$46(NO$/$@(B +$B$5$$!#(B\TeX{}$B%U%!%$%k$NKAF,!J(B|\documentclass|$B$h$jA0!K$G(B +\begin{verbatim} + \RequirePackage{exppl2e} +\end{verbatim} +$B$H=q$/$3$H$G!"3+H/HG$r%F%9%H$9$k$3$H$,$G$-$^$9!#(B +$B%P%0Js9p$d$40U8+$r4?7^$7$^$9!#(B +\TeX\ Forum$B$d(BGitHub$B$N(BIssue$B%7%9%F%`$,MxMQ$G$-$^$9!#(B +\begin{itemize} +\item \texttt{https://github.com/texjporg/platex} +\item \texttt{https://github.com/texjporg/uplatex} +\end{itemize} + +\end{document} diff --git a/Master/texmf-dist/source/platex/base/plvers.dtx b/Master/texmf-dist/source/platex/base/plvers.dtx index 421ed0a6a93..2550dc18048 100644 --- a/Master/texmf-dist/source/platex/base/plvers.dtx +++ b/Master/texmf-dist/source/platex/base/plvers.dtx @@ -139,7 +139,7 @@ {2018/03/09} %</plcore|platexrelease> %<*plcore> -\def\ppatch@level{0} +\def\ppatch@level{1} %</plcore> % \end{macrocode} % \end{macro} diff --git a/Master/texmf-dist/tex/platex/base/exppl2e.sty b/Master/texmf-dist/tex/platex/base/exppl2e.sty index eaaf3bc6538..ed4430d05a3 100644 --- a/Master/texmf-dist/tex/platex/base/exppl2e.sty +++ b/Master/texmf-dist/tex/platex/base/exppl2e.sty @@ -2,7 +2,7 @@ % % This is file `exppl2e.sty', for experimental pLaTeX2e. % -% Copyright (c) 2016-2017 Japanese TeX Development Community +% Copyright (c) 2016-2018 Japanese TeX Development Community % % This file is part of the pLaTeX2e system (community edition). % ------------------------------------------------------------- @@ -34,7 +34,7 @@ % case 1: This file must be a normal package \NeedsTeXFormat{pLaTeX2e} \ProvidesPackage{exppl2e} - [2017/12/06 v1.0r Experimental pLaTeX2e features] + [2018/03/12 v1.0t Experimental pLaTeX2e features] \PackageWarningNoLine{exppl2e}{% This is the unstable, experimental part of pLaTeX2e.\MessageBreak This package may contain:\MessageBreak @@ -542,15 +542,16 @@ % $B?eJ?%b!<%I$G$"$l$P$=$N$^$^(B|\inhibitglue|$B$rH/9T$7!"$=$l0J30$G$"$l$P(B % |\everypar|$BFb$K(B|\inhibitglue|$B$r;E9~$_$^$9!#(B % \changes{v1.2x}{2018/03/01}{\cs{everypar}$B$K(B\cs{inhibitglue}$B$r;E9~$`%^%/%mDI2C(B} +% \changes{v1.2y}{2018/03/12}{\cs{inhibitglue}$B$r(B\cs{everypar}$B$NKvHx$K0\F0(B} % \begin{macrocode} %<platexrelease>\plIncludeInRelease{2018/03/09}{\pltx@next@inhibitglue} %<platexrelease> {Add \pltx@next@inhibitglue}% %<*plcore|platexrelease> \protected\def\pltx@next@inhibitglue{% \ifhmode\inhibitglue\else - \edef\@tempa{\everypar{\inhibitglue + \edef\@tempa{\everypar{% \everypar{\unexpanded\expandafter{\the\everypar}}% - \unexpanded\expandafter{\the\everypar}}}% + \unexpanded\expandafter{\the\everypar}\inhibitglue}}% \@tempa\fi} %</plcore|platexrelease> %<platexrelease>\plEndIncludeInRelease diff --git a/Master/texmf-dist/tex/platex/base/platexrelease.sty b/Master/texmf-dist/tex/platex/base/platexrelease.sty index 9ff963103b1..619c40ecb90 100644 --- a/Master/texmf-dist/tex/platex/base/platexrelease.sty +++ b/Master/texmf-dist/tex/platex/base/platexrelease.sty @@ -131,6 +131,8 @@ of this package available from CTAN} some critical bugs. We advise you to\MessageBreak select another format date} \plIncludeInRelease{2017/10/28}{\PackageWarning}{pLaTeX Info}% + % * <2018/03/09>+1 + % * <2018/03/09> % * <2017/10/28>+4 \plEndIncludeInRelease \plIncludeInRelease{2017/07/29}{\PackageWarning}{pLaTeX Info}% @@ -1319,9 +1321,9 @@ of this package available from CTAN} {Add \pltx@next@inhibitglue}% \protected\def\pltx@next@inhibitglue{% \ifhmode\inhibitglue\else - \edef\@tempa{\everypar{\inhibitglue + \edef\@tempa{\everypar{% \everypar{\unexpanded\expandafter{\the\everypar}}% - \unexpanded\expandafter{\the\everypar}}}% + \unexpanded\expandafter{\the\everypar}\inhibitglue}}% \@tempa\fi} \plEndIncludeInRelease \plIncludeInRelease{0000/00/00}{\pltx@next@inhibitglue} diff --git a/Master/texmf-dist/tex/platex/base/plcore.ltx b/Master/texmf-dist/tex/platex/base/plcore.ltx index 288406422f2..8d723a272a8 100644 --- a/Master/texmf-dist/tex/platex/base/plcore.ltx +++ b/Master/texmf-dist/tex/platex/base/plcore.ltx @@ -19,7 +19,7 @@ \def\pfmtname{pLaTeX2e} \def\pfmtversion {2018/03/09} -\def\ppatch@level{0} +\def\ppatch@level{1} \edef\platexBANNER{\the\everyjob\noexpand\typeout{}\relax}% save LaTeX banner \newif\if@plincludeinrelease \@plincludeinreleasefalse @@ -1107,9 +1107,9 @@ \@sharp\unskip\@endpbox}} \protected\def\pltx@next@inhibitglue{% \ifhmode\inhibitglue\else - \edef\@tempa{\everypar{\inhibitglue + \edef\@tempa{\everypar{% \everypar{\unexpanded\expandafter{\the\everypar}}% - \unexpanded\expandafter{\the\everypar}}}% + \unexpanded\expandafter{\the\everypar}\inhibitglue}}% \@tempa\fi} \def\@tabular{\leavevmode \null\hbox \bgroup $\let\@acol\@tabacol \let\@classz\@tabclassz |